Analysis
The most recent figure for meat, total — production, annual growth rate in United Arab Emirates is 1.04 % change on previous year,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of down 88.9% on the previous year and down 81.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, meat, total — production, annual growth rate in United Arab Emirates peaked at 36.89 % change on previous year in 1980 and was at its lowest, -26.42 % change on previous year, in 1975.
That places United Arab Emirates 105th out of 212 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Meat, Total — Production.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Meat, Total — Production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
